Flower Mound family displaced after house fire
A Flower Mound family lost their home overnight in a fire. Just before 1 a.m. Saturday, smoke detectors awakened the three occupants of the home in the 1800 block of Marble Pass Lane, according to the Flower Mound Fire Department. They safely evacuated and called 911. Three dogs and one cat were rescued from the home, but one cat died in the fire before firefighters were able to extinguish the blaze.

Retail thieves arrested in Colleyville with $10,000 in stolen goods
COLLEYVILLE, Texas — Two suspects were arrested by Colleyville police while attempting to steal skincare and beauty products from local retailers. The suspects targeted multiple stores across the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ex before being apprehended by Colleyville Detectives and Patrol Officers, according to the Colleyville Police Department. A search of their vehicle revealed more than $10,000 in stolen skincare and beauty products, a 9mm pistol with an extended magazine, and a fictitious paper license plate.
